2025 Compare Cities Climate:
Fortuna, CA vs Hayward, CA

Change Cities
Highlights
- Hayward has 63.0% less rainy days than Fortuna.
- Hayward has 45.2% more Sunny Days than Fortuna.
- On the BestPlaces comfort index, Hayward scores 11.5% better than Fortuna
